Grundfos Cooling as a Service submits patent application for the algorithm to establish energy efficiency baseline of chiller plants


Efficiency is the key characteristic to compare when understanding if energy can be saved in a chilled water system. The new algorithm from Grundfos Cooling as a Service makes it faster, easier, and simpler to establish efficiency measures.


Issues solved


When power consumption is not available for a chilled water system the bare minimum of information is missing. No power consumption is a serious roadblock to establishing the efficiency

When the cooling load is missing the second half of the information needed to establish the efficiency is missing. With the new algorithm, this is no longer a roadblock!  

The algorithm behind Monitor & Report uses detailed power consumption data and information about the chilled water system design to estimate the cooling load. The efficiency can be calculated from the power consumption and the estimated cooling load.

Measurements require calibrated sensors, recording of the sensor signals, and storage of the data. Not all sensors are equally difficult to manage. Measuring electrical signals is quite robust whereas flow, pressure, and temperature are more delicate. The algorithm behind Monitor&Report reduces the hassle by using electrical measurements only.

For well-instrumented systems, time series data needed to calculate efficiency can typically be found in the control- or BMS system. In some cases, the chilled water system efficiency can even be read directly from here. When this is the case, all that is needed is to understand what measurements are behind the efficiency calculation.

We have seen systems where the data is a bit more scattered, and the export of several sensor readings must be used and wrangled to get to the efficiency number we are after.
